GOT A CHANCE TO FISH TODAY, FIRST OFF
WAS THE GOON WITH THE LAUNCH RAMP
BEING REBUILT, NO LAUNCHING SO THAT
MENT PIRU....... WATER LEVELS DOWN AROUND
15FT, AND ALOT OF SPOTS DRIED UP,,,,

WATER TEMP WAS AT 71 AND FISH BITING;
ALL FISH WERE ON STRUCTURE HOLDING
TIGHT,


REASNOR STARTING TO DRY UP FOR THE
FALL DRAW DOWN,,,
